Search results set to percentage width (bug introduced in Sistersearch A/B test)
Closed, ResolvedPublic

Description

A bug was introduced with the Sister search A/B test T149806 that sets the search results to a percentage width instead of the previously static 38em width. This change was made to accommodate a sidebar. It's not very visible on desktop (for large displays I would say it's even preferable), but very bad on mobile.
